Sustainable Development – the Idea, Perspectives and Challenges
The publication is a multi-disciplinary monograph, which consists of eleven texts devoted to the problem of sustainable development. The authors – Warsaw University scientists – are experts in physics, biology, chemistry, geology, economics, sociology, law, geography, spatial management and security sciences. They direct their attention to the concept of sustainable development and the possibilities of its practical application, and in this context, they interpret on a global scale economic and social mechanisms, such as: the possibility to feed the human race, regulation of water use, environmental pollution and appropriate legal regulations. They are considering the possibility of a just green transition in the European Union and building climate security, as well as real alternatives to sustainable development as a principle of world regulation. It is the third publication in the series aimed at popularizing the achievements of science and published under the auspices of the Green Dialogue Platform of the University of Warsaw.
